网友收藏 文章浏览阅读1.8k次。//最小数和最大数向中间遍历,最大数为number开平方取整//如果两数平方之和等于number,返回true//如果两数平方之和小于number,最小数加一//如果两数平方之和大于number,最大数减一//循环结束找不到返回falsep......
2024-01-22 19:26 阅读
阅读全文 网友收藏 文章浏览阅读1.4k次。例 5=1*1+2*2;首先解决问题需要用到循环,可以双重循环 ,找到 a, b ,aa+bb=x 返回#include<iostream>using namespace std;int main(){ int n; cin>>n; int a,b,i=0; for(a=0;a<=n;a++) { for(b=0;b<=n;b++) { if((a*a+b*b)==n&&......
2024-01-22 19:26 阅读
阅读全文 网友收藏 文章浏览阅读2.3k次。2017.10.24只查找一半就可以,如果全部查找的话,会超时。public class Solution { public boolean checkSumOfSquareNu_判断平方和是否为平方数...
2024-01-22 19:26 阅读
阅读全文 网友收藏 文章浏览阅读840次。同时给你两个正整数k1和k2。你可以将nums1中的任意元素+1或者-1至多k1次。数组nums1和nums2的差值平方和定义为所有满足0_左右方差和最小 leetcode...
2023-11-11 21:02 阅读
阅读全文 网友收藏 方和科技专销售“加加明”是总代理,创新科技产品“加加明”电子气动近视眼防治仪是公司历经10年研发的国家发明专利产品。加加明开创爱眼护目新时代,铸就中华百年健康业!全国服务热线:010-82057855...
2024-01-15 20:23 阅读
阅读全文 网友收藏 文章浏览阅读5.4k次。为了学习scala,在网上加了个QQ群,群主非要做道题才能加入。题目如标题,要求必须在50个字符内,因为添加好友的验证框就能输入50个字符,于是乎,实现如下:1.方法一 (1 to 100).filter(x=>(x%2)!=0).map......
2024-01-23 12:20 阅读
阅读全文 网友收藏 文章浏览阅读436次。给一个整数c, 你需要判断是否存在两个整数a和b使得a^2 + b^2 = c.样例样例 1:输入 : n = 5输出 : true说明 : 1 * 1 + 2 * 2 = 5样例 2:输入 : n = -5输出 : falseclass Solution {public: /** * @param num: the gi..._如何判断一个整数......
2024-01-22 19:26 阅读
阅读全文 网友收藏 判断给定的数是否为两个数平方的和,可以通过查找范围内的两个数平方的和是否等于给定的数来判断。通过比较来移动指针,直到找到或者指针交叉。...
2024-01-22 18:23 阅读
阅读全文 网友收藏 文章浏览阅读945次。哈哈,这题网上竟然没有找到答案,于是自己copy到VS里面调试了几次终于AC了,不保证是最优的算法,时间复杂度应该是O(nlogn),空间复杂度O(1)(循环里面嵌套了一个二分查找),万一有人需要呢,分享一下~......
2024-01-22 19:26 阅读
阅读全文 网友收藏 文章浏览阅读488次。四平方和四平方和定理,又称为拉格朗日定理:每个正整数都可以表示为至多4个正整数的平方和。如果把0包括进去,就正好可以表示为4个数的平方和。比如:5 = 0^2 + 0^2 + 1^2 + 2^27 = 1^2 + 1^2 + 1^2 + 2^2(^符号表......
2024-01-22 18:54 阅读
阅读全文